Abstract

To investigate the dynamic characteristics of a plasma synthetic jet (PSJ), we used dynamic pressure sensors and high-speed schlieren method to study the similarities and differences of the dynamic characteristics of PSJ under the same PSJ structural and electrical parameters. It was observed that the excitation frequency of the jet measured by the above two approaches was consistent with the discharge frequency of PSJ under the test actuation frequency. When the actuation frequency was between 100 Hz and 200 Hz, the jet duration in one cycle obtained by the schlieren was about 12% longer than that measured by the dynamic pressure sensor. While the excitation frequency was reduced to 50 Hz, the jet duration measured by the schlieren became shorter than that got by the dynamic pressure sensor. Although the specific values of the jet velocity of PSJ measured by the two methods were different, the trend of the peck velocity was similar obtained by the schlieren and pressure sensor.
